Web Scraping: A Beginner's Guide
Web scraping is a process for programmatically gathering data from websites . Essentially, it’s like teaching a computer to parse a page and pull out the desired pieces of information you need . While it sounds complex , the fundamentals are surprisingly straightforward to understand , particularly for those new to the world of automation. This guide will provide a concise overview of the primary concepts, software, and potential considerations involved.

Ethical Web Scraping: Best Practices & Legal Considerations
Navigating the realm of data gathering from the internet requires a clear understanding of ethical guidelines and applicable legal regulations. Ethical web data mining begins with honoring website robots.txt files, which specify permitted usage and prohibit certain sections. Always use a polite scraping approach, including adjusting request rates to minimize server strain and identifying a clear identifier in your scraper's user header. Furthermore, be mindful of terms of service and copyright laws; copying copyrighted content without consent can lead to court consequences. Finally, assess the possible impact on the platform's operation and verify your actions are transparent and compatible with ethical practice.
Web Scraping Tools Compared: Python vs. Scrapy vs. Octoparse
Choosing the ideal application for web data mining can be an challenge. Python, with its extensive libraries like Beautiful Soup and Requests, provides tremendous adaptability – you can a capable choice for developers needing have some programming knowledge. Scrapy, the Python platform, delivers improved speed and architecture during larger projects, but requires a greater advanced comprehension. Conversely, Octoparse is an graphical tool intended for people without significant programming knowledge, allowing them to quickly extract data of web pages.
Sophisticated Web Scraping Techniques : Managing Changing Data & APIs
Moving beyond basic HTML analysis , advanced web data mining necessitates addressing dynamic web sites . These often rely on asynchronous JavaScript to display content after the initial application appears. Successful scraping in such scenarios involves techniques like headless browser emulation – essentially, mimicking a human user's actions. Furthermore, numerous contemporary web platforms offer their data through APIs , which present a organized method to web data acquisition, often providing more reliable and productive information. Learning to interact with these interfaces is vital for any dedicated web scraping .
Automate Data Collection: A Practical Web Scraping Workflow
To systematically acquire data from the web, think about implementing a web scraping workflow. First, you'll need to locate your target sources. Then, choose a fitting software, such as Python with libraries like Beautiful Soup or Scrapy. Following this, outline your harvesting rules – which data points to extract. After that, verify your scraper with Web Scraping a limited dataset to ensure accuracy and avoid blocking. Lastly, schedule the routine for recurring data updates, keeping your information fresh. This method permits you to automatically obtain valuable data without human effort.
